Related QuestionsWhat is the default encoding?
Java Internationalization FAQThe default encoding is selected by the JRE based on the host operating system and its locale. For example, in the US locale on Windows, windows-1252 is used. In the Simplified Chinese locale on Solaris, GB2312, GBK, GB18030, or UTF-8 can be the default encoding, depending on the selection made when logging into Solaris. The default encoding is significant because the JRE commonly exchanges text with the host operating system in the default encoding.

Related QuestionsXML: How Do I Add A New Encoding To AmphetaDesk?
AmphetaDesk - Frequently Asked QuestionsAmphetaDesk 0.93.2 and above ship with a number of default encodings, which you can see by browsing the lib/XML/Parser/Encodings/ directory. As the name suggests, these all come from the XML::Parser::Encodings Perl module, which also contains some scripts to make your own from encoding maps freely available online. Once you've got the encoding.enc file, drop it into lib/XML/Parser/Encodings/ and test it out on a feed that requires it.

Related QuestionsHow do I undeclare the default XML namespace?
rpbourret.com - XML Namespaces FAQTo "undeclare" the default XML namespace, you declare a default XML namespace with an empty (zero-length) URI reference. Within the scope of this declaration, unprefixed element type names do not belong to any XML namespace. For example, in the following, the default XML namespace is the http://www.foo.org/ for the A and B elements and there is no default XML namespace for the C and D elements. Related QuestionsHow does the character encoding of the XML document affect the parsing performance?
NET Compact Framework Team : .NET Compact Framework version ...The .NET Compact Framework implements decoders for UTF8, ASCII and UTF16 (big- and little- endian) encodings in managed code. All other encodings, such as all ANSI codepage encodings involve a PInvoke down to the operating system. So using UTF8, ACII and UTF16 is usually faster. If you don???t use international characters (outside of the ASCII character set) use UTF8 or ASCII (these have approximately equal performance). Try to avoid using Windows codepage encodings.
